Inadequate Air Conditioning Performance



What causes inadequate air conditioning performance in an a/c system? Several elements can add to this problem. An usual reason is a filthy air filter, which limits air movement and reduces cooling down effectiveness. Furthermore, low cooling agent levels as a result of leaks can prevent the system's ability to soak up heat effectively. An additional potential issue might develop from a malfunctioning thermostat, leading to wrong temperature analyses and incorrect cooling cycles. Obstructed or unclean condenser coils can also protect against heat dissipation, additional impacting performance. Ductwork problems, such as leakages or obstructions, can result in unequal air conditioning throughout a room. Determining these troubles quickly is essential for preserving ideal cooling and heating function and making sure a comfortable interior setting. Regular maintenance and assessments can aid reduce these concerns and enhance the system's general efficiency.




Unusual Noises Originating From the A/c Unit



A range of uncommon noises coming from an AC device can show underlying concerns that need attention. Typical noises consist of rattling, which might suggest loosened parts or debris within the unit. Hissing noises commonly aim to refrigerant leakages, endangering the system's performance. A grinding audio can show damaged bearings or electric motor concerns, while a shrill screech could indicate a trouble with the compressor or a sliding belt.


Each of these sounds offers as an indication that something might be amiss, potentially bring about more considerable damages otherwise addressed promptly. Homeowners should stay clear of ignoring these acoustic hints and think about seeking advice from a qualified a/c service technician for diagnosis and repair work. Frequent Biking On and Off



Constant cycling on and off can indicate inadequacies or malfunctions within a cooling and heating system, usually described as short-cycling. This condition can lead to boosted energy consumption and might create unneeded endure the unit's components. Numerous elements can add to this trouble, consisting of an incorrectly sized air conditioning system, a malfunctioning thermostat, or filthy air filters. When an air conditioning device is also large for the area, it cools too rapidly, triggering it to cycle regularly without sufficiently evaporating the air. If the thermostat is defective, it may inaccurately indicate the unit to switch on and off. In addition, obstructed or filthy air filters can restrict air flow, motivating the system to work more challenging and cycle much more commonly. Dealing with these issues quickly is vital to enhance efficiency, prolong the life-span of the cooling and heating system, and keep optimal interior convenience.


Water Leakages and Water Drainage Issues





Water leaks and water drainage concerns can pose considerable difficulties for HVAC systems, bring about potential damages and ineffectiveness. These issues often Continue stem from clogged up condensate drains pipes, which avoid water from draining pipes effectively and can cause overflow. In addition, harmed drainpipe pans or improper installation may worsen these leaks, causing water to build up in unwanted areas.




Normal maintenance is vital to avoid such issues; making sure that condensate lines are clear and drain pans are undamaged can reduce the risk of leakages. Home owners should routinely examine for signs of dampness around the system, as early discovery can stop a lot more comprehensive damage. In situations where leaks are identified, prompt action is required, which might include removing blockages or changing defective parts. Dealing with water leakages and drainage issues not just safeguards the HVAC system yet also preserves interior air high quality and convenience.


Bad Smells and Air High Quality Problems



Bad odors originating from cooling and heating systems can suggest significant air quality worries. Usual resources of these undesirable scents include mold, mold, or bacteria growth in the ductwork, frequently because of moisture buildup. If the system has an undesirable, moldy odor, it might signify that the air filters are obstructed or that there is insufficient ventilation, enabling pollutants to circulate. Additionally, a burning smell might recommend electric problems or overheating elements, needing immediate attention.


Homeowners need to regularly change air filters and timetable routine maintenance to guarantee peak air top quality. Making use of an air purifier can also help remove odors and improve interior air high quality. What Is the Average Lifespan of an Air Conditioning Unit?



The average lifespan of an air conditioner unit usually varies from 15 to 20 years. Factors such as maintenance, usage patterns, and environmental problems can substantially affect this duration, impacting total effectiveness and performance in time.
